More specifically, it relates to a roofing material that is mainly used on the roofs of balconies, terraces, carports, etc. of houses, and whose purpose is to prevent rainwater, let in natural light, or adjust the amount of transmitted light. Conventionally, corrugated sheets made of vinyl chloride resin or glass fiber reinforced synthetic resin have been used as roofing materials for balconies, terraces, carports, etc.

However, the above-mentioned conventional roofing materials have various drawbacks.

That is, rainwater first separates and flows into the recesses of the corrugated sheet, and since the flow rate is small, dirt tends to accumulate on the surface of the recesses of the corrugated sheet.
When fixing corrugated sheet roofing materials to crosspieces, beams, or main buildings, the corrugated portions of at least two peaks are overlapped and hook bolts are inserted to secure the corrugated sheet metal. Rust penetrates into the overlapping parts of roofing materials and accumulates, and rust from hook bolts runs off, further staining the surface of the roofing materials, resulting in a significant deterioration in aesthetic appearance.

In addition, conventional corrugated sheet roof panels lacked sufficient rigidity and had the disadvantage of making flapping noises when blown by the wind.

In order to prevent this, it is necessary to use a large number of fixing devices such as hook bolts to firmly fix it to the crosspiece or beam.
Inserting a fixing device such as a hook bolt has the drawbacks mentioned above, which increases the possibility of leakage from the fixing hole, which increases the amount of work required to tighten the fixing device at high places, and is dangerous. At the same time, the complexity of construction increases. The present invention solves the above-mentioned disadvantages, and has excellent aesthetic appearance without the accumulation of dirt on the surface due to rainwater, dirt, dust, etc., and the parts to be fixed to branches or beams are at least firmly fixed, and the rigidity is improved. The object of the present invention is to provide a roofing material that does not make a flapping sound even when it is blown by the wind because of its large size.
Next, an example of the present invention will be explained with reference to the drawings. FIG. 1 shows the side profile of an example of the roof village of the present invention. The plate-shaped body 1 has an arch shape with a central portion protruding upward, and is formed into a double-layer structure having a large number of reinforcing connecting plates 2. Slanted slope portions 3, 3 are provided obliquely upward from the green portions on both sides of the arch-shaped plate-like body 1. The inclined plate parts 3, 3 are curved,
The side edges are turned sideways. The roofing material of the present invention is made of, for example, a polyvinyl chloride resin and is extruded into a profile, and is made entirely transparent or translucent to allow sunlight to enter. Connection locking portion 4 in which a conical projection 5 is provided on the inside of the tip from the lower end of the side end surface of the left side slant plate portion 3 in FIG.
is provided above, and a connecting locking portion 4 is provided below, in which a conical protrusion 5 is provided from the upper end of the side end surface of the right inclined plate portion 3 to the inside of the tip. Each of the conical projections 5, 5 is made to protrude inside the connecting locking parts 4, 4, and can be tightly engaged with each other. On both side twills of the plate-shaped body 1,
The gutter grooves 6, 6 are formed by the slopes of the plate-shaped body 1 and the slope parts 3, 3.
is formed. In addition, horizontal plates 7, 7 are provided on the back side of the green portions on both sides of the plate-shaped body 1, and approximately parallel narrow insertion grooves 8 are provided.
, 8 are formed. Figure 2 shows another example of a rooftop village. The arch-like plate-like body la has two arches. A gutter groove 6a' is formed between the two arches of the arch-shaped plate-like body la, and a closing groove 8a' is provided on the back side. Since the plate-shaped body 1 has an arched cross-sectional shape, the rigidity of the entire roofing material is improved, and fewer points are required for fixing it to beams and main buildings, improving the strength of the entire structure such as a carport. It does not deform due to the wind or load, and does not make flapping noises due to the wind.

When these roofing materials are fixed to the crosspieces, beams, and main building, the plate-shaped body 1 also expands and contracts in the middle direction due to the difference in temperature between summer and winter.

With conventional corrugated roofing materials, when there is expansion and contraction, the overlap between adjacent roofing materials makes it impossible to absorb the large amount of expansion and contraction, which can lead to damage. With the roofing material of the present invention, even if both side edges of the plate-like body 1 are fixed, since the plate-like body 1 has an arch-like cross-sectional shape, the top part absorbs expansion and contraction by slightly moving up and down. In the roof village of the present invention, most of the rainwater is received by the plate-like body 1, but the rainwater is collected through the gutter grooves 6 on both sides of the plate-like body 1,
6, and the water is washed away without dirt adhering to the upper surface of the plate-like body 1.

In the gutter grooves 6, 6, a certain amount of flow rate and flow velocity is obtained from the rainwater drained from the plate-shaped body 1, and the dust and disks are washed away without accumulating, so that they do not turn into dirt and deteriorate the aesthetic appearance of the roofing material. .
In the roofing material of the present invention, in contrast to the connecting locking portion 4 provided at the side end of one inclined slope portion 3, the connecting locking portion 4 is provided at the side end of the other inclined plate portion 3 of another adjacent roofing material. The connection and locking parts 4 can be connected to each other by iron-locking from above to below.
The state in which several roofing materials are connected is shown in FIG.

The detailed state of the joints between the roofing materials is shown in FIGS. 4 and 5. Since the connecting part between the roofing materials is located at the apex of the small arch formed by the inclined plate parts 3, 3,
Rainwater does not stop near the apex of the small arch, but quickly flows down into the gutter grooves 6, 6. If the connecting locking parts 4, 4 are firmly connected, rainwater can penetrate into the connecting parts of roof villages. This prevents rain from leaking. In conventional corrugated sheet roofing materials, at least two corrugated peaks of adjacent roofing materials are overlapped and connected, but rainwater, along with dust and bonito, permeates through the overlapped portions by capillary action and can cause leaks. However, since the roofing material of the present invention connects the roofing materials to each other by locking the connecting locking parts 4, 4, rainwater does not penetrate into the connecting part and dirt does not accumulate in the connecting part. In addition, connecting only the connecting locking parts 4, 4 on the side edges of the roofing material by overlapping each other saves on materials, and when used for daylighting, there is no extreme shading of brightness, resulting in better daylighting. It will be done. To connect the roofing materials, a pair of opposing insertion grooves 8.8 are formed below the connection part.

This pair of insertion grooves 8, 8 are formed in a fixed part of the roof panel. How the roofing material is fixed to the crosspieces, beams, and main building is shown in FIGS. 4 to 6. That is, the edges of the fixing plate 10 are inserted into the insertion grooves 8, 8, and the roofing material is fixed to the beam or the main building. In the roof material shown in FIG. 2, the insertion groove 8a' in the center can be firmly fixed to the main building by inserting the fixing plate.
9 is a main building made of C-shaped steel, which is connected to pillars of a balcony, terrace, carport, etc.

On the main building 9, both ends of the fixed plate 10 are inserted into the insertion grooves 8, 8.
The fixing plate 10 and the main house 9 are tightened by the fixing tool 11.

The main building 9 is fixed by the insertion grooves 8, 8 on the back side of the roofing material and the fixing plate 10.
By being fixed to the roof, it is possible to avoid providing a fixing device insertion hole in the Murone village itself, and the work of fixing the roofing material can be done from below the roofing material, making the construction easier. To insert the fixing plate 10 into the insertion grooves 8, 8 of the roofing material, as shown in FIG. This can be done by rotating it. By fixing the roof material plate 1 to the main building 9 at the green parts on both sides, twisting of the both side edges of the plate 1,
There will be no distortion and no deformation due to wind or load. Since both roofing materials are fixed to the main building 9 below the connecting portion between the roofing materials, the connecting portion between the roofing materials is prevented from coming off due to external force such as wind blowing. That is, by fixing the roofing materials to the main building 9 at the center, etc., the connection between the roofing materials is prevented from being blown away by the wind.
The insertion grooves 8, 8, which serve as fixing parts for the roofing material, should be provided on the back side of both side twills, which are the thickest of the entire roofing board of the plate-shaped body 1, to ensure the best fit before the roofing material is installed. It can be stacked and the stacking packaging volume can be reduced by 4.
